About the role
AllerVie is seeking a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) to join our specialty clinic team focused on allergy and immunology care. This role involves administering injections, supporting allergy testing and immunotherapy, and ensuring accurate documentation in the EMR.
Responsibilities
- Administer allergy injections, immunotherapy, and biologic medications under provider supervision
- Perform patient intake, collect vital signs, and assist with clinical assessments and allergy testing (e.g., skin testing, spirometry, Niox)
- Accurately document all clinical activities and patient encounters in the EMR system
- Maintain a clean, well-stocked, and compliant clinical environment
- Support inventory tracking, medication prep, and cold chain management
- Collaborate with providers, clinical coordinators, and the biologics team to ensure smooth, patient-centered care
Qualifications, Education, and Experience
- Active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) license in the state of practice
- Current BLS certification required
- 1–2 years of clinical experience in an outpatient, specialty, or primary care setting preferred
- Experience administering injections, immunotherapy, or biologic medications strongly preferred
- Familiarity with allergy/immunology protocols, spirometry, and patient intake processes a plus
- Proficient in documenting in electronic medical record (EMR) systems
- Strong communication, multitasking, and patient education skills
- Ability to work collaboratively in a fast-paced, team-oriented clinical environment
